How To Fix CACSTGT033 - Elementary target &1 &2 is of type &3, without a correct actual value


CACSTGT033 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: CACSTGT - Commissions: Target Agreements

  • Message number: 033

  • Message text: Elementary target &1 &2 is of type &3, without a correct actual value
